package org.ow2.easybeans.component.quartz;
import java.util.Arrays;
import java.util.Calendar;
import java.util.List;
import org.testng.Assert;
import org.testng.annotations.Test;
/**
* Test increments
* @author Florent Benoit
*/
public class TestIncrements {
@Test
public void testBasicIncrementsSeconds() {
List<Integer> allValues = Arrays.asList(new Integer[] {0,5,10,15,20,25,30,35,40,45,50,55});
ScheduleValueIncrements scheduleValueIncrements = new ScheduleValueIncrements("*", 5, Calendar.SECOND);
boolean minuteHasChanged = false;
Calendar now = Calendar.getInstance();
int i = 0;
while (i < 100) {
ValueResult res = scheduleValueIncrements.getTimeAfter(now);
now.set(Calendar.SECOND, res.getResult());
if (res.needsIncrement()) {
now.add(Calendar.MINUTE, 1);
minuteHasChanged = true;
}
Assert.assertTrue(allValues.contains(now.get(Calendar.SECOND)));
now.add(Calendar.SECOND, 1);
i++;
}
Assert.assertTrue(minuteHasChanged);
}
@Test
public void testOtherIncrementsSeconds() {
List<Integer> allValues = Arrays.asList(new Integer[] {45,48,51,54,57});
ScheduleValueIncrements scheduleValueIncrements = new ScheduleValueIncrements("45", 3, Calendar.SECOND);
boolean minuteHasChanged = false;
Calendar now = Calendar.getInstance();
int i = 0;
while (i < 30) {
ValueResult res = scheduleValueIncrements.getTimeAfter(now);
now.set(Calendar.SECOND, res.getResult());
if (res.needsIncrement()) {
now.add(Calendar.MINUTE, 1);
minuteHasChanged = true;
}
Assert.assertTrue(allValues.contains(now.get(Calendar.SECOND)));
now.add(Calendar.SECOND, 1);
i++;
}
Assert.assertTrue(minuteHasChanged);
}
@Test
public void testOtherIncrementsHours() {
List<Integer> allValues = Arrays.asList(new Integer[] {19,22});
ScheduleValueIncrements scheduleValueIncrements = new ScheduleValueIncrements("19", 3, Calendar.HOUR_OF_DAY);
boolean hourHasChanged = false;
Calendar now = Calendar.getInstance();
int i = 0;
while (i < 30) {
ValueResult res = scheduleValueIncrements.getTimeAfter(now);
now.set(Calendar.HOUR_OF_DAY, res.getResult());
if (res.needsIncrement()) {
now.add(Calendar.DAY_OF_MONTH, 1);
now.set(Calendar.MINUTE, 0);
now.set(Calendar.SECOND, 0);
hourHasChanged = true;
}
Assert.assertTrue(allValues.contains(now.get(Calendar.HOUR_OF_DAY)));
now.add(Calendar.MINUTE, 28);
i++;
}
Assert.assertTrue(hourHasChanged);
}
}
